上一页 1 ··· 5 6 7 8 9 10 11 12 13 14 下一页
摘要: 题目大意 给定两个偶数 x,yx,yx,y。 求一个 n∈[1,2×1018]n \in [1,2\times10^{18}]n∈[1,2×1018] 满足 n mod x=y mod nn \bmod x = y \bmod nnmodx=ymodn。 ttt 组数据。 对于 100%100\%1 阅读全文
posted @ 2021-11-12 19:13 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给一个长度为 nnn 的序列 aaa,对于每个位置 iii,如果 ai mod (i+1)≠0a_i \bmod (i+1)\ne0ai​mod(i+1)=0,就可以将 aia_iai​ 删掉。 删掉之后,后面的数都会往前面移动一位。 问能否将序列删成空。 对于 100%100\%100 阅读全文
posted @ 2021-11-12 18:08 蒟蒻orz 阅读(4)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给出一个长度为 nnn 的整数序列 aaa,将其划分为 kkk 个连续子串。 设 h1,h2,h3...hkh_1, h_2, h_3...h_kh1​,h2​,h3​...hk​ 是每个子串的最长上升字序列的长度。 求是否有一种划分方式使得 h1⊕h2⊕h3⊕...⊕hn=0h_1 \o 阅读全文
posted @ 2021-11-12 17:53 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给出一个数列 aaa,求出需要在 aaa 序列中插入多少个数可以将 aaa 变成一个合法序列。 合法序列的定义是:∀1≤i≤∣a∣,ai≤i\forall 1 \leq i \leq |a|,a_i \leq i∀1≤i≤∣a∣,ai​≤i。 ttt 组数据。 对于 100%100\%10 阅读全文
posted @ 2021-11-12 17:44 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 桌子上有 nnn 堆牌,每张牌上都有一个正整数。 A 可以从任何非空牌堆的顶部取出一张牌,B 可以从任何非空牌堆的底部取出一张牌。 A 先取,当所有的牌堆都变空时游戏结束。 他们都想最大化他所拿牌的分数(即每张牌上正整数的和)。 问他们所拿牌的分数分别是多少? 解题思路 经典的博弈论。 显 阅读全文
posted @ 2021-11-07 13:22 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 好久没写 AC 自动机了,来一发套线段树的题解吧。 题目大意 给定包含 kkk 个字符串的集合 SSS,有 nnn 个操作,操作有三种类型: 以 ? 开头的操作为询问操作,询问当前字符串集S中的每一个字符串匹配询问字符串的次数之和; 以 + 开头的操作为添加操作,表示将编号为 iii 的字符串加入到 阅读全文
posted @ 2021-11-07 13:02 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 在本题中,我们用 fif_ifi​ 来表示第 iii 个斐波那契数 f1=f2=1,fi=fi−1+fi−2(i≥3)f_1=f_2=1,f_i=f_{i-1}+f_{i-2}(i\ge 3)f1​=f2​=1,fi​=fi−1​+fi−2​(i≥3)。 给定一个 nnn 个数的序列 aa 阅读全文
posted @ 2021-11-07 00:07 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 有 qqq 次操作和一个集合 AAA,开始时集合中只有一个数 000,下面有三种类型的操作: + x,把 xxx 插入集合 AAA。 - x,把 xxx 从集合 AAA 中删去,保证 xxx 已存在于集合 AAA 中。 ? x,给一个数 xxx 在集合 A 中找一个 yyy 使得 xxor 阅读全文
posted @ 2021-11-05 19:24 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给定一个 n,kn,kn,k,有一个数列 20,21,22,23,...2^0,2^1,2^2,2^3,...20,21,22,23,...,第 iii 个数为 2i−12^{i-1}2i−1。 特别的,若第 kkk 个数,2k−1≥k2^{k-1} \ge k2k−1≥k,就将第 kkk 阅读全文
posted @ 2021-11-02 12:52 蒟蒻orz 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 题意大意 给定一个字符串 sss,定义 AB(s)\mathrm{AB}(s)AB(s) 为 sss 中串 ab 出现的次数,BA(s)\mathrm{BA}(s)BA(s),为 ba 出现的次数。 每次可以修改一个字符,要求通过尽量少的操作 ,使得 AB(s)=BA(s)\mathrm{AB}(s 阅读全文
posted @ 2021-11-01 13:51 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 有 nnn 个整数的数列,由数字 [1,n][1, n][1,n] 构成,同时还有 mmm 对交换 (ai,bi)(a_i, b_i)(ai​,bi​),表示交换位置 aia_iai​ 和位置 bib_ibi​ 上的值,这些交换可以使用 000 到多次。 现在希望通过这些交换,获得最大的排 阅读全文
posted @ 2021-10-31 14:47 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给定两个大小为 nnn 的序列 ai,bia_i,b_iai​,bi​,求有多少个数对 (l,r)(l,r)(l,r),满足 1≤l≤r≤n1\le l\le r\le n1≤l≤r≤n 且 max⁡i=lrai=min⁡i=lrbi\max_{i=l}^r a_i=\min_{i=l}^ 阅读全文
posted @ 2021-10-31 13:46 蒟蒻orz 阅读(0)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给定一个数 nnn,求最小的 ttt,使得存在恰好 nnn 个不同的等比数列 a1,a2,a3,a4a_1,a_2,a_3,a_4a1​,a2​,a3​,a4​,满足 1≤a1<a2<a3<a4≤t1\le a_1<a_2<a_3<a_4\le t1≤a1​<a2​<a3​<a4​≤t。 阅读全文
posted @ 2021-10-31 13:25 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 水题解的一天。 题目大意 给定 nnn 个点 任意两点 i,ji,ji,j 间有权值为 ∣i−j∣|i-j|∣i−j∣ 的双向边,另有 nnn 条权值为 111 的单向边,求以 111 为起点的单源最短路径。 1⩽n⩽2000001\leqslant n\leqslant2000001⩽n⩽2000 阅读全文
posted @ 2021-10-31 13:14 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 若将一个串 BBB 复制多遍,然后拼接起来,拼接时可将两个模板串相同的部分叠起来,最后得到一个串 AAA。 我们称串 BBB 是串 AAA 的模板串。 现给定一个字符串,试求出这个字符串的最短模板串,输出这个长度。 解题思路 考虑一个串 AAA 的,他的最短模板串为 BBB,那么具体组成就 阅读全文
posted @ 2021-10-07 16:26 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给定一函数 fff,对任意正整数 nnn 满足: ∑d∣n=n\sum\limits_{d|n}^{}=nd∣n∑​=n。 先给 nnn 个数,a1,a2,…ana_1,a_2,\dots a_na1​,a2​,…an​,试求出 ∑i=1nf(ai)\sum\limits_{i=1}^{n 阅读全文
posted @ 2021-10-07 15:25 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 外星人又双叒叕要攻打地球了,外星母舰已经向地球航行!这一次,JYY 已经联系好了黄金舰队,打算联合所有 JSOIer 抵御外星人的进攻。 在黄金舰队就位之前,JYY打算事先了解外星人的进攻计划。现在,携带了监听设备的特工已经秘密潜入了外星人的母舰,准备对外星人的通信实施监听。 外星人的母舰 阅读全文
posted @ 2021-10-04 19:16 蒟蒻orz 阅读(9) 评论(0) 推荐(0) 编辑
摘要: 题目大意 试求出一个字符串每一个长度为偶数的后缀在原字符串中出现的次数。 对于 100%100\%100% 的数据,∣S∣≤200000|S| ≤ 200000∣S∣≤200000。 解题思路 比较简单。 对这个字符串建 AC 自动机,然后建上 fail 树。 那么一个长度为偶数的前缀在原字符串中出 阅读全文
posted @ 2021-10-04 14:37 蒟蒻orz 阅读(3) 评论(0) 推荐(0) 编辑
摘要: 传送门 题目大意 给定一个 nnn 个点和 mmm 条边的无向图,每条边都有一个 [l,r][l,r][l,r] 的限制,请计算出从 111 到 enenen 的限制范围是多少(即路径上 lll 尽量小,rrr 尽量大)。 100%100\%100% 的数据 2<=N<=1000,0<=M<=300 阅读全文
posted @ 2021-10-04 14:37 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题解 好久没写博客了,更一下吧。。 其实这场比赛个人感觉是比较考思维的,不过数据有点水。 总长 444 小时,满分 400400400 分,我打了 333 小时,拿了 300300300 分,就因有事走人了。 比较遗憾。 T1 『JROI-3』R.I.P. 签到题 O(kn)\mathcal{O}( 阅读全文
posted @ 2021-10-03 23:40 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 求整数 aaa 到 bbb 的数的 lowbit 之和。 解题思路 枚举找规律。 #include <bits/stdc++.h> using namespace std; #define int long long int a, b; const int _ = 10000000; in 阅读全文
posted @ 2021-09-25 13:15 蒟蒻orz 阅读(8) 评论(0) 推荐(0) 编辑
摘要: 题目大意 有 nnn 个串,s1,s2,…sns_1,s_2,\dots s_ns1​,s2​,…sn​。 试构造一个长度为 kkk(kkk 是给定的)的串 xxx,使得对于 ∀1≤i≤n,si\forall 1 \leq i \leq n,s_i∀1≤i≤n,si​ 在 xxx 中的出现次数之和最 阅读全文
posted @ 2021-09-24 21:24 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 题目大意 有 nnn 个字符串 S1,S2,⋯ ,SnS_1, S_2, \cdots, S_nS1​,S2​,⋯,Sn​ 和一个字符串集合 TTT,一开始 TTT 为空。 然后有两个操作: 1 P 往 TTT 里加一个字符串 PPP。 2 x 询问集合 TTT 中有多少个字符串包含串 SxS_xS 阅读全文
posted @ 2021-09-24 19:44 蒟蒻orz 阅读(2) 评论(0) 推荐(0) 编辑
摘要: 题目大意 对于以下公式: v=a1∗a2∗...∗ankv=\frac{a_1*a_2*...*a_n}{k}v=ka1​∗a2​∗...∗an​​ 已知 nnn 和 kkk 且 ∀1≤i≤n,1≤ai≤m\forall 1 \leq i \leq n, 1 \leq a_i \leq m∀1≤i≤ 阅读全文
posted @ 2021-09-20 14:30 蒟蒻orz 阅读(5) 评论(0) 推荐(0) 编辑
摘要: 题目大意 给出一个 nnn 行 mmm 列的矩阵,求从 (1,1)(1,1)(1,1) 到 (n,m)(n,m)(n,m) 途中最少要改变几次方向。 每一个点上有一个字母,分别表示: UUU,到这个点后不能向上移动; DDD,到这个点后不能向下移动; LLL,到这个点后不能向左移动; RRR,到这个 阅读全文
posted @ 2021-09-20 14:30 蒟蒻orz 阅读(1) 评论(0) 推荐(0) 编辑
上一页 1 ··· 5 6 7 8 9 10 11 12 13 14 下一页